Transaction 86a98d0efb80559ceca3ad44fecc62d00033f0011a5f2d49cac7d04278117a08
1 Input
1 Output
-
86a98d0efb80559ceca3ad44fecc62d00033f0011a5f2d49cac7d04278117a08:0
- value
- 999806
- script pubkey
- OP_0 OP_PUSHBYTES_20 cef3dbd110ef13b48d11ebe9be1b1e307cd2d35d
- address
- bc1qemeah5gsaufmfrg3a05muxc7xp7d956ajmuxht